What is a Lower Forward Control Arm?


A lower forward control arm is a crucial part of a vehicle's suspension system, typically found in independent suspension layouts. This component connects the vehicle's chassis to the wheel hub, playing a vital role in maintaining proper wheel alignment and stability while driving. Lower forward control arms are commonly constructed from a variety of materials, including steel, aluminum, or composite materials, providing a balance between weight, strength, and durability.


Functions of Lower Forward Control Arms


The primary functions of lower forward control arms are to support the vehicle's weight, manage steering dynamics, and absorb shock from the road. By connecting the wheels to the vehicle's chassis, they facilitate vertical and horizontal movement while ensuring that the wheels remain aligned with the chassis. This alignment is crucial for optimal handling, ride comfort, and tire longevity.


1. Weight Support The lower forward control arms help bear the vehicle's weight, ensuring the suspension system operates smoothly. A robust control arm can significantly impact the overall stability of the vehicle, especially during turns and sudden maneuvers.


2. Steering Control As the driver steers the vehicle, the lower forward control arms allow for directional changes, correlating closely with the steering system's performance. Discrepancies in control arm functionality can lead to steering instability and poor handling.

3. Shock Absorption The control arms work in conjunction with other suspension components, such as shocks and struts, to absorb road irregularities. This function ensures a smoother ride for passengers and minimizes the impact of bumps, potholes, and other road imperfections.


Benefits of High-Quality Lower Forward Control Arms


Investing in high-quality lower forward control arms has numerous benefits for vehicle owners. They include


- Enhanced Stability and Handling A well-designed control arm contributes to improved driving dynamics, ensuring that the vehicle handles predictably and responsively. This is particularly beneficial in scenarios requiring precise steering and agility, such as navigating sharp turns.


- Increased Safety Properly functioning lower forward control arms are essential for maintaining correct wheel alignment, which is crucial for tire wear and overall vehicle safety. Misalignment can lead to uneven tire wear, increased stopping distances, and reduced traction, posing risks to the driver and passengers.


- Durability and Longevity Quality control arms made from durable materials can withstand the rigors of daily driving, reducing the frequency of replacements and repairs. This longevity not only saves money but also enhances the reliability of the vehicle.
